Output a58faeffc1175cdac73d84a45bfbf1ce180eb88900dfb3273e824964f79d802a:1

value
2844986
script pubkey
OP_0 OP_PUSHBYTES_20 cc66eca9db9bc3529277c3059f7ac0302d7e3457
address
bc1qe3nwe2wmn0p49ynhcvze77kqxqkhudzhy6vq0g
transaction
a58faeffc1175cdac73d84a45bfbf1ce180eb88900dfb3273e824964f79d802a